Is your computer lagging? It might be mining crypto in the background without your knowledge.

Currently, many users are unaware that their PCs are running at full power for someone else’s benefit. A hidden miner virus is a trojan that secretly uses your machine’s GPU and CPU to mine cryptocurrency. Often, a regular antivirus won’t detect it.

What should you pay attention to?

If you notice these signs, it’s time to check:

  • Your computer suddenly started lagging – CPU is loaded at 60%+ for no obvious reason
  • Graphics card is extremely hot and noisy – the cooler is constantly running at maximum
  • Internet traffic spikes – the miner is active 24/7 and constantly sending data
  • Unknown processes in Task Manager – like Asikadl.exe or a string of random characters
  • Browser is extremely sluggish – if a virus script is embedded on a website

How to get rid of it in 10 minutes?

Option 1: Quick method

  1. Run your antivirus (even the built-in Windows Defender) – give it a deep scan
  2. After that, run CCleaner – it will clean up the junk left by the virus
  3. Restart your computer

Option 2: Manually via the registry (if the antivirus found nothing)

  • Win+R → type regedit → OK
  • Ctrl+F → search by the suspicious process name
  • Delete all found entries → restart

Option 3: Through Task Scheduler

  • Win+R → type taskschd.msc → OK
  • Find the “Task Scheduler Library” folder
  • Check all tasks for suspicious names
  • Right-click → “Disable” or “Delete”

If nothing helps, install Dr. Web; it does a deeper scan than standard antivirus programs.

How to avoid getting a miner?

  • Always update Windows and your antivirus
  • Don’t visit suspicious sites without https://
  • Scan files before downloading
  • Don’t run programs as administrator without a reason
  • In Chrome/Firefox with built-in crypto-mining protection, disable JavaScript in your browser
  • Block dangerous sites through the hosts file (there are lists on GitHub)

Lifehack: Install AdBlock or uBlock – they often block browser-based mining before it starts.
